Comparative Advantage
The ability of an entity to produce a good or service at a lower opportunity cost than others, leading to specialized production and trade.
Absolute Advantage
The ability of an individual, company, or country to produce a good or service at a lower cost per unit than competitors.

Consumer Surplus
The difference in the total potential spending by consumers on a good or service versus the actual expenditure.
